It sounds like the original eM Client V8.x might have been open in the background and didnât close the process 100% at that time.
Uninstall eM Client and when asked do you want to delete the database choose âNoâ and after uninstall, if you have Windows check that the âeM Client folderâ C:\Program Files (x86)\eM Client has been deleted. If not manually delete it.
Then install the latest version of eM Client again which should pickup your exiting EMC database and open ok.
